I think the Salts will probably be a bubble team next season. They were a bubble team for the majority of the season this year until they went through their unprecedented slide. They will certainly be adding better players this year and have both the cap room to out-bid everyone, as well as draft capital up the ying-yang, and have a lot of good young players on the team already.
It is difficult to handicap it right now, but it would not surprise me at all to see them in the playoffs this upcoming season. That's going to be the most interesting team to follow for the next few seasons.

I think it's going to be fascinating to have Utah in play. The Coyotes have been "rebuilding" for so long it's hard to remember when they were actually relevant. They've become infamous for taking on bad money to just reach the floor and collecting draft picks in the process.
33 picks in the next 3 years. Crazy. They have a boatload of young players and an owner who will want to make them relevant much much sooner than the previous one. It will be super interesting.
